2. Golden Dragon Restaurant
Spacious interior, traditional decor, extensive menu

Embark on a culinary adventure at Golden Dragon Restaurant during their Sunday brunch, where you can savor an array of delectable dim sum delicacies. From siomai to hargow and from pot stickers to chicken feet, each dish showcases the chef's expertise and dedication to authenticity. For those with a sweet tooth, the egg tarts and baked custard buns are a must-try, despite being a tad too sweet for some palates. However, be mindful of potential ingredients like MSG, as some diners reported feeling dizzy post-meal. Despite this, the overall dining experience at Golden Dragon Restaurant promises a flavorful journey through the heart of Cantonese culinary tradition.
